Written Answers. - New Secondary Schools.

468.

asked the Minister for Education the criteria which must be met by persons seeking to open new secondary schools in respect of (a) enrolment; (b) catchment area; and (c) continuity, before the teachers in such a school will be entitled to incremental salary from his Department.

The general regulations for the recognition of secondary schools and the additional regulations for the recognition of new schools are set out in sections II and III of the Rules and Programme for Secondary Schools, which is published annually and placed on sale at the Government Publications Sale Office, GPO Arcade, Dublin 1, and which is also available in the Oireachtas Library.

Teachers are within the incremental salary in accordance with the provisions of the rules for the payment of incremental salary as from the date from which the school is given provisional recognition in accordance with the rules for secondary schools.
